> To save yourself a few steps in the future, consider using the program
> 'wget' on the server to download the source code directly to the server.
> Usage is like:
>
> wget URL_HERE

> I have a version of the source from 1999 on a RaQ2. I just extracted it
> using:
>
> tar xfvz wwwcount2.5.tar.gz
>
> In the unpacked code there's a file called 'configure' that you can use to
> install it.
That functioned very good, but what do actually "xfvz" mean ?
>
> ./configure --help for options. Unless you change the location it installs
> to by default you'll definitely have to be 'root' to install it. Hopefully
> that will get you started. If I recall correctly it's an easy install if
> you follow the directions, though it's probably a year and a half since I
> installed it anywhere.
